Output 4eb3075b082dfd6c958d5eb8ad61a30b03ecea9b714940a274d214cc33dcba14:5

value
17674715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df8740c097d5cfd3221b9af1594e7d6e7e5a4f5e OP_EQUAL
address
3N4vdrtDt4F1KBwXMhFRLHbY5Z9GAGjuMB
transaction
4eb3075b082dfd6c958d5eb8ad61a30b03ecea9b714940a274d214cc33dcba14
confirmations
463421
spent
true